Description
Containing data on screening and information on the federal mandates on education services to the disabled, this text focuses on managing children with developmental disabilities and outlining common disorders of development and learning. The book's practical approach includes: discussing theories of development and learning in two conceptual chapters; covering topics such as developmental screening, early detection and intervention and general management; and addressing specific disorders as described by definition, prevalence, etiology, pathophysiology, assessment, management and outcomes.

Content
Part 1 Assessment, management and general interventions: theories of development and learning; measures of development and learning; development screening; general management techniques; early intervention; child abuse and development disabilities. Part 2 Specific disorders: disorders of motor development; cerebral palsy; myelodysplasia; disorders of speech and language; disordes of mental development; general issues; Down syndrome; fragile X syndrome; foetal alcohol syndrome; pervasive development disorders; autism; academic disorders; learning disabilities; attention deficit hyperactive disorder; disorder; disorders of sensation; hearing and visual impairments; the developmental consequenes of prematurity.
